Tangut (Himalayan, South Asian, ... Styles and Periods (hierarchy name))

 

Note: Culture of Tibetan-related ethnic group historically living at the terminus of the Silk Road in what is now northwestern China. The Tangut kingdom of Xixia flourished from 1038 until 1227.
